SOME/IP协议详解「2.0·服务化通信概述」点击返回雪云飞星的SOME/IP协议详解「总目录」SOME/IP协议详解「2.0·服务化通信概述」1SOME/IP服务的组成2Method|Event|Field2.1Method2.2Event2.3Field3小结1SOME/IP服务的组成someip提供基于网络的面向服务的通信机制,而每个服务一般都是由相近或相关的一些功能组成。在someip中规定服务中可以包含三种接口,这三种接口对应了我们在SOME/IP协议详解「1.1·面向服务与面向信号」中讲解的事件发送、方法调用和字段处理。在someip中称为Methond、Event和Field,
iptables和iproute是两个不同的工具,它们在不同的阶段执行不同的功能。iproute是用来管理和控制路由表的,它决定了数据包应该从哪个网卡或网关发送出去。iptables是用来配置、管理和控制网络数据包的过滤、转发和转换的,它根据用户定义的规则对数据包进行检查、修改或丢弃。一般来说,iproute先于iptables执行,因为路由表是在内核中最先处理数据包的部分。当内核收到一个数据包时,它会先查看路由表,找到合适的出口网卡或网关,然后将数据包发送出去。在发送之前,内核会根据iptables中的规则对数据包进行过滤、转发或转换。例如,内核可能会根据NAT规则更改数据包中的源地址或目
由于测试环境多次出现ip冲突问题,为了节约时间,整理以下定位步骤,协助测试同事快速找到发生ip冲突的设备第1步:首先判断ip是否冲突使用命令arping-Iethxxxx.xxx.xxx.xxx,若返回多个MAC,则表示IP冲突通过查看自己主机192.168.190.66的MAC地址,确定发生ip冲突的设备mac地址为40:A6:B7:51:D2:FD第2步:登录环境的汇聚交换机(以华三交换机为例),查看arp表,确认ip地址192.168.190.66发生突出的mac地址从哪个接口学习到的;(由于ip冲突已解决,所以下面提供的图片与第一步展示的图片并不对应;下面以冲突mac7C:C3:85:
Nginx做黑白名单机制,主要是通过allow、deny配置项来实现:allowxxx.xxx.xxx.xxx;#允许指定的IP访问,可以用于实现白名单。denyxxx.xxx.xxx.xxx;#禁止指定的IP访问,可以用于实现黑名单。要同时屏蔽/开放多个IP访问时,如果所有IP全部写在nginx.conf文件中定然是不显示的,这种方式比较冗余,那么可以新建两个文件BlockIP.conf、WhiteIP.conf:#--------黑名单:BlockIP.conf---------deny192.177.12.222;#屏蔽192.177.12.222访问deny192.177.44.201
6种方法在Linux系统中查看IP地址在terminal输入命令或ifconfig或ipaddr或ipaddress或ipaddrshow或ipaddressshowifconfig命令:在终端输入ifconfig命令,它会显示当前系统中所有网络接口的配置信息,包括IP地址、子网掩码和网关等。ip命令:在终端输入ipaddr命令,它会列出当前系统中所有网络接口的详细信息,包括IP地址、子网掩码和网关等。nmcli命令:在终端输入nmclideviceshow命令,它会显示网络管理器中所有网络设备的信息,包括IP地址、子网掩码和网关等。参考:3种方法来在Linux系统中查看IP地址
环境:当电脑有双网卡或者双IP时,需要增加静态路由来同时访问2个网络网卡2配置:IP:192.168.1.7掩码:255.255.255.0网关:192.168.1.1网卡2配置:IP:10.253.251.6掩码:255.255.255.0(不配置网关)步骤:1、首先在“运行”窗口输入cmd(按WIN+R打开运行窗口),然后回车进入命令行,输入routeadd10.253.251.0mask255.255.255.0-p192.254.1.1。其中10.253.251.0是源地址,255.255.255.0是源地址掩码,192.254.1.1是目标地址;2、输入routeprint,然后回车
一、CentOS修改IP地址修改对应网卡的IP地址的配置文件vi/etc/sysconfig/network-scripts/ifcfg-eth0修改以下内容DEVICE=eth0#描述网卡对应的设备别名,例如ifcfg-eth0的文件中它为eth0BOOTPROTO=static#设置网卡获得ip地址的方式,可能的选项为static,dhcp或bootp,分别对应静态指定的ip地址,通过dhcp协议获得的ip地址,通过bootp协议获得的ip地址BROADCAST=192.168.0.255#对应的子网广播地址HWADDR=00:07:E9:05:E8:B4#对应的网卡物理地址IPADDR=
伪造http请求ip地址我们知道正常的tcp/ip在通信过程中是无法改变源ip的,也就是说电脑获取到的请求ip是不能改变的。但是可以通过伪造数据包的来源ip,即在http请求头加一个x-forwarded-for的头信息,这个头信息配置的是ip地址,它代表客户端,也就是HTTP的请求端真实的IP。因此在上面代码中加上如下代码:httpPost.addHeader("x-forwarded-for",ip);服务端通过x-forwarded-for获取请求ip,并且校验IP安全性,代码如下:Stringip=request.getHeader("x-forwarded-for");总结通过请求头
步骤一:登录阿里云或腾讯云,编辑服务器绑定的安全组,添加ip白名单如图:步骤二(不使用宝塔的忽略此步):在宝塔界面中放行6379端口步骤三:修改redis.conf注释掉"bind127.0.0.1"并将"protected-modeyes"改为"protected-modeno"重启redisOK~,现在你白名单的ip就可以访问你的redis啦白名单ip下的服务器运行如下命令即可你的redisredis-cli-hxx.xx.xx-p6379-aredispassword注意事项安全组切勿把6379端口开放给所有ip,否则很可能被挖矿备忘录redis启动/重启命令/etc/init.d/re
文章目录互联网基础应用和数据应用的起源应用的实现——数据数据的产生数据传输网络参考模型与标准协议OSI模型TCP/IP参考模型TCP/IP之物理层常见传输介质TCP/IP之数据链路层以太网与MAC地址以太网的定义:MAC地址以太网报文格式TCP/IP之网络层IP协议IPV4报文格式生存时间(TTL)协议号(Protocol)IP地址:什么是IP地址IP地址表示IP地址构成:IP地址寻址IP地址分类(有类编址)IP地址类型IP地址计算:私有IP地址特殊IP地址IPV4与IPV6子网划分为什么我们要划分子网?如何进行子网划分ICMP协议ICMP差错控制TCP/IP之传输层报文格式端口号TCP的建立